We don't actually own a physical board so if we want to play in the real world (as opposed to the virtual world), we have to borrow a board and all the bits that go with it - the rules are freely available to download on the web. So I put on my Blue Peter thinking cap and got busy.


An old grass battle mat, a pair of scissors, a steel rule, a pencil and a couple of hours of measuring, cutting and marking lines with white paint. That's the basic recipe and technique for a homemade pitch, copying the measurements from a real board. I added a couple of touches of my own, blood stains, mud patches and even a message from the game sponsors. All I need now are the blocking dice, a range measure, and plenty of lucky rerolls!

How did you get the lines on the pitch. Okay I can imagine the white lines were handy enough. Its the fine dark lines I am really wondering about! The pitch looks great.

Nord said...

I marked out the lines with a steel rule and blunt pencil. The pencil scores a line through the surface of the grass mat. The white lines are just painted on, the dark crosses at the intersections of the grid I marked with a felt tip pen.

If I was doing it again, I would cut a wider piece and mark out the dugouts too.
